[oe] [PATCH] devmem2: ensure word is 32-bit, add support for 64-bit double

Andre McCurdy armccurdy at gmail.com
Wed Jun 20 00:58:29 UTC 2018


On Tue, Jun 19, 2018 at 4:42 PM, Denys Dmytriyenko <denis at denix.org> wrote:
> From: Denys Dmytriyenko <denys at ti.com>
>
> Since sizeof(unsigned long) can be 8-byte on 64-bit architectures, use
> uint32_t instead for "word" access to always be 4-byte/32-bit long.
>
> Also introduce proper "double" 8-byte/64-bit access by using uint64_t.

The busybox version of devmem (which seems to be the "upstream" for
devmem development activity, such as it is) has already picked "l" as
the command line option for 64bit values.
